Sadly, here Brown is hoist with his own petard. What he doesn’t realize is that there is no such thing as “the pressures of selection”—it is a metaphor, a descriptor of what happens when different genes (i.e. “alleles”, or forms of a single type of gene) leave different number of copies.   That differential reproduction of genes is what constitutes natural selection,, and it is a process of gene sorting.

There are no “pressures” of selection imposed on the organism from the outside. What happens, as everyone knows who learns introductory evolution, is that, in a given environment, some genes leave more copies than others, usually because they increase the reproductive output of their possessor.  Take, for example, a population of brown bears that somehow find themselves in a white-colored environment, like the Arctic.  There are genes affecting coat color, and imagine that a given gene comes in several forms, one of which makes the bear lighter in color than do the alternative forms.  This being a population of bears, there will be variation among their genes due to mutation. Those bears carrying the “light” forms of genes might do better than their browner confrères because they’re more camouflaged in the snow, and thus better at sneaking up on seals and killing them.  “Light-gene” bears will be better fed, and thus have better survival and (crucially) more offspring. (If the color change affects survival but not reproductive output, no natural selection ensues.)  In the next generation, the proportion of color genes having the light form will be higher than before. And the average color of the bear population will be a bit lighter.

If this continues over many generations, and other mutations occur that yield even lighter coats, natural selection will move the bears from brown to white. Presumably this is what happened in polar bears, whose ancestors were probably brown. And it’s happened in many Arctic animals whose ancestors were brown but evolved white color (either pemanently or seasonally) via natural selection. Such animals include the Arctic fox, the Arctic hare, the ptarmigan, the snowy owl, the harp seal, and so on (see a list here).

arctic-animals-main
What “selection” pressures can do: white Arctic mammals.

Note that the environment isn’t exerting any “pressure” here. It is simply providing a milieu in which one gene has an advantage over another. The environment cannot see the genes and their constituent DNA. We speak of “selective pressure to become light-colored” as simple shorthand for the process I’ve described above.

Let me add, since I’m writing about physics for my book now (kudos to Sean Carroll, my Official Physics Tutor™), that the term “laws of physics” is also a metaphor, or a shorthand descriptor.  There are no “laws of physics,” but just regularities in the universe that appear to be ubiquitously “followed”.  People like Brown might argue that the term “laws” implies “lawgiver” and hence God—a confusing misconception unwittingly promulgated by atheistic physicists.  But again, this metaphor is not confusing—except, perhaps, to theists who want to see those laws having been decreed by God.

As one reader pointed out yesterday, metaphors, often involving the use of anthropomorphizing, are ubiquitous in all of science, not just evolutionary biology. “Selfish gene” is just one of these.  I would argue that anyone who can’t understand, after a minute’s explanation, that selfish genes really aren’t conscious and malevolent entities, is lacking some crucial rationality.  Likewise, it’s not hard to see how “selfish genes” can lead to cooperative behavior.  That, too, is easily explained, and has been done many times by Dawkins and others. Lest you think I’ve forgotten my Beatles songs, I haven’t: there are nine favorites to go. Revolver (1966), my favorite Beatles album, contains this gem: a lovely ballad that comes in at #25 on Rolling Stone’s list of the 100 greatest Beatles songs. It’s pure McCartney (with his voice multi-tracked), though of course the writing credits go to Lennon/McCartney. The tune is surprisingly melancholy for a love song. Another surprise is its melodic complexity: tons of diverse parts that interlock seamlessly.

I share the composers’ sentiments, and by that I include Lennon, who isn’t known for his fondness of non-edgy ballads:

McCartney has repeatedly identified it as one of his best compositions, a sentiment echoed by his songwriting partner: Lennon told Playboy in 1980 that it was “one of my favorite songs of the Beatles.”

It still amazes me that someone can produce such a beautiful song in a matter of an hour or so: minutes, really, if you count the framework. No matter how hard I try, and if I had a lifetime to write one song, I couldn’t come close to this one.

Rolling Stone explains the genesis:

McCartney wrote it at Lennon’s house in Weybridge while waiting for Lennon to wake up. “I sat out by the pool on one of the sun chairs with my guitar and started strumming in E,” McCartney recalled. “And soon [I] had a few chords, and I think by the time he’d woken up, I had pretty much written the song, so we took it indoors and finished it up.” McCartney has cited the Beach Boys’ Pet Sounds as his primary influence for “Here, There and Everywhere.” McCartney had heard the album before it was released, at a listening party in London in May 1966, and was blown away.

The tune’s chord sequence bears Brian Wilson’s influence, ambling through three related keys without ever fully settling into one, and the modulations — particularly the one on the line “changing my life with a wave of her hand” — deftly underscore the lyrics, inspired by McCartney’s girlfriend, actress Jane Asher. (The couple, whose careers often led to prolonged separations, would split in July 1968.) When George Martin heard the tune, he persuaded the musicians to hum together, barbershop-quartet style, behind the lead vocal. “The harmonies on that are very simple,” Martin recalled. “There’s nothing very clever, no counterpoint, just moving block harmonies. Very simple . . . but very effective.”

And a bit more history:

The group spent three days in the studio working on the song, an unusually long time for a single track during this period. After agreeing on a satisfactory rhythm track, the band did backing vocals, then McCartney recorded his lead vocal — which had a surprising inspiration. “When I sang it in the studio, I remember thinking, ‘I’ll sing it like Marianne Faithfull’ — something no one would ever know,” he said. “I used an almost falsetto voice and double-tracked it. My Marianne Faithfull impression.”
